MGRS Decoded

MGRS encodes location as a nested hierarchy — zone, band, grid square, and offsets. Here is what each component of 31UFQ8014243998 means.

Component Value Meaning
UTM Zone 31 One of 60 vertical slices of Earth (6° wide each). Zone 31 runs 0° to 6° longitude.
Latitude Band U One of 20 horizontal bands (8° tall each), lettered C–X (skipping I and O). Indicates the general latitude region.
100 km Square FQ A 100 × 100 km grid square within the zone/band. Column letter F (west–east) and row letter Q (south–north).
Easting 80142 Distance east within the 100 km square. 5-digit value = 10 m resolution. Multiply by 1 to get meters.
Northing 43998 Distance north within the 100 km square. Same resolution as easting (10 m).

Geohash Precision

A geohash encodes coordinates by subdividing the Earth into progressively smaller cells. Each extra character roughly halves the cell area. The table below shows Verdun-Le Rozelier Airfield's geohash at every precision level alongside the bounding box each level represents.
